Question 3: What is data triangulation?
- Using only one data source
- Collecting data without analysis
- Using multiple methods or data sources to ensure accuracy (Correct answer)
- Avoiding data verification
Correct answer: Using multiple methods or data sources to ensure accuracy
Data triangulation is a research technique that involves using multiple data sources, methods, investigators, or theories to study the same phenomenon. This approach enhances the validity and reliability of research findings by providing a more comprehensive and robust understanding of the subject matter.

Question 6: What is the role of coding in qualitative data analysis?
- To program software
- To count numbers only
- To group data into meaningful categories (Correct answer)
- To avoid conclusions
Correct answer: To group data into meaningful categories
In qualitative data analysis, coding is the process of identifying, organizing, and categorizing segments of text or other data into themes or concepts. This systematic process helps researchers to make sense of large amounts of unstructured data, uncover patterns, and develop deeper insights into the research topic.
Question 7: What is reliability in data collection?
- Random results
- Inconsistent outcomes
- Consistent and repeatable measurements (Correct answer)
- Flexible data tools
Correct answer: Consistent and repeatable measurements
Reliability in data collection refers to the consistency and stability of a measurement tool or method. A reliable measure will produce the same or very similar results if the measurement is repeated under the same conditions, indicating that the data collected is dependable and free from random error.
Question 8: Which type of variable is measured on a numeric scale?
- Categorical
- Nominal
- Quantitative (Correct answer)
- Ordinal
Correct answer: Quantitative
Quantitative variables are those that can be measured numerically, representing quantities or amounts. These variables can be discrete (e.g., number of children) or continuous (e.g., height, weight), and they allow for mathematical operations and statistical analysis.
Question 9: What is the first step in data analysis?
- Writing conclusions
- Visualizing data
- Cleaning and preparing data (Correct answer)
- Publishing results
Correct answer: Cleaning and preparing data
Before any meaningful analysis can occur, data must be cleaned and prepared. This crucial first step involves identifying and correcting errors, handling missing values, removing duplicates, and transforming data into a suitable format, ensuring the accuracy and integrity of subsequent analytical processes.
